** The pest control market serving Wells Tannery, PA, is characterized by regional providers from hubs like Chambersburg, Bedford, and Altoona, rather than local in-town businesses. Due to the rural nature of Fulton County, services often include a travel fee. The competition is moderate, with a mix of large national brands (like Rentokil) and strong regional specialists (like Varmenta) vying for customers. The average quality is high, as companies operating in this region must be versatile, handling everything from common household insects to significant wildlife issues. Typical pricing for a standard pest control plan starts at approximately **$45-$75 per month** for quarterly services, with one-time treatments for specific issues like ants or rodents ranging from **$150-$400**. Wildlife removal and exclusion services are more specialized and costly, typically starting at **$300+** depending on the animal and extent of the problem. Termite treatments and bed bug extermination are premium services, often costing **$1,200 to $2,500+** due to the materials and labor involved. Most reputable companies offer free inspections and quotes.

Due to our rural setting in Fulton County and the surrounding forests and farmland, homeowners in Wells Tannery most commonly deal with rodents (mice, voles), stinging insects (wasps, yellowjackets), and occasional nuisance wildlife like raccoons or skunks. Seasonal timing is key: rodents seek shelter in late fall, stinging insect nests peak in late summer, and increased ant activity is common in the humid Pennsylvania springs and summers. Proactive treatment just before these seasonal surges is most effective.
Costs vary based on the pest, property size, and service type. For example, a one-time interior/exterior treatment for ants or spiders might range from $125-$250. Ongoing quarterly services, which are recommended for consistent prevention, typically cost between $45-$75 per visit. Wildlife removal (e.g., raccoons in an attic) is more specialized and costly, often starting at $300+. Always get itemized quotes from local providers.
Yes. Any company applying pesticides in Pennsylvania must be licensed by the Pennsylvania Department of Agriculture (PDA). You should always verify this license. For wildlife issues, the Pennsylvania Game Commission regulates the trapping and relocation of many species. A reputable local provider will know these regulations, such as specific rules for handling protected species or proper bait station use for rodents.

Reputable pest control companies serving Wells Tannery will conduct a thorough property assessment and use targeted methods and products that pose minimal risk to your well water and septic field. They should follow Integrated Pest Management (IPM) principles, using non-chemical controls first and applying any pesticides judiciously and away from wellheads and drainage areas. Always inform your technician about your well and septic system location.
